Overview
Details about the link between two data flow operators. This class has direct subclasses. If you are using this class as input to a service operations then you should favor using a subclass over the base class

.get_subtype(object_hash) ⇒ Object
Given the hash representation of a subtype of this class, use the info in the hash to return the class of the subtype.
82 83 84 85 86 87 88 89 90 91 |
# File 'lib/oci/data_integration/models/flow_port_link.rb', line 82 def self.get_subtype(object_hash) type = object_hash[:'modelType'] # rubocop:disable Style/SymbolLiteral return 'OCI::DataIntegration::Models::InputLink' if type == 'INPUT_LINK' return 'OCI::DataIntegration::Models::OutputLink' if type == 'OUTPUT_LINK' return 'OCI::DataIntegration::Models::ConditionalInputLink' if type == 'CONDITIONAL_INPUT_LINK' # TODO: Log a warning when the subtype is not found. 'OCI::DataIntegration::Models::FlowPortLink' end |
